No. It is an adjective. It is describing word, not a name for something (noun).
eg... He is a cute boy. - cute is the adjective, boy is the noun.

Yes, "cuteness" is an abstract noun. It refers to the quality or state of being cute, which cannot be physically touched or measured. Abstract nouns denote concepts, qualities, or conditions rather than tangible objects.
